Abstract

This analysis of the representations that University students (18-22 years old) explain and support about the knowledge of Biology and their ways of production in a first year subject of a university course of studies of Licenciate in Sciences is presented in this paper. Changes made in their interpretations are triggered by teaching activities that promote the constructions of comprehension and argumentation showing important differences in learning regarding the knowledge of sciences and Biology are also evaluated in this paper. The work was done with a pre and post test design, using as indicators the different textual, discursive and metacognitive productions of the students (drawings, sketches, graphics and arguments). A qualitative and quantitative analysis of the answers along the teaching of a four-month period was carried out.
